Upgrading SignalExpress Tektronix Edition to LabVIEW SignalExpress Results in Limited Functionality

Problem:
I own SignalExpress Tektronix Edition (or SignalExpress 1.2). I recently installed some National Instruments software and upgraded my version of SignalExpress from the Tektronix Edition to the newest version, L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5. After the upgrade, I tried to use my SignalExpress Tektronix Edition serial number to activate L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5 and it did not work. I had full functionality of the product for 30 days, and now I see a message stating that my trial period of L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5 Full Edition is over and I now have L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5 Limited Edition. What happened and how do I get back all of the functionality I had in the SignalExpress Tektronix Edition?

Solution:
If you installed a version of LabVIEW, NI-DAQmx, or the NI Driver CD from August 2007 or later, your version of SignalExpress may have been upgraded from SignalExpress Tektronix Edition to the new L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5.  During the installation you had the option to de-select installation of L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5, but by default this option is selected.  The full functionality of L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5 should have been available for 30 days along with your Tektronix steps.  After the 30 day trial of L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5 Full Edition expires, you can choose one of the following options to continue using your SignalExpress Tektronix Edition steps:

  • Upgrade to L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5 Full and Retain Tektronix Edition Steps
    You can choose to upgrade to L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5 and still retain your Tektronix Edition steps.  If you installed L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5 from a L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5 installation CD, your product came with an activation code that you can use at any time to activate the full product.  If you do not have an activation code for L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5, you can contact NI to upgrade to the full edition of L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5.

  • Uninstall L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5 and Retain Tektronix Edition Steps
    If you do not want to use any of the functionality introduced in L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5, you can uninstall L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5 and reinstall SignalExpress Tektronix Edition.  You will then be able to use your old serial number to reactivate the product.

  • Continue Using LabVIEW Signal Express 2.5 Limited Edition with Tektronix Edition Steps
    If you do not want to upgrade to L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5 Full Edition, you can continue to use L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5 Limited Edition and will not need to register LabVIEW SignalExpress. You will retain the Tektronix Edition steps, but much of the other functionality that you had available in the Tektronix Edition is not available in the Limited Edition of LabVIEW SignalExpress 2.5.
